USD 261 EDUCATIONAL SUPPORT STAFF
POSITION
DESCRIPTION
POSITION TITLE:
MIDDLE SCHOOL SECRETARY
SUPERVISOR:
Principal
PAYMENT RATE
According to Educational Support Staff Salary Schedule
QUALIFICATIONS
High School diploma or equivalent. Computer skills. Working knowledge of office equipment. Telephone skills. Demonstrate ability to manage regular office routines. Maintain current TB testing as required by Health Department regulations (after employment offer is made).
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
Provide office and clerical support to the principal and staff to ensure the smooth operations in the middle school office. Read, file, record and route incoming mail and/or messages for the purpose of effective communication within the building. Prepare outgoing mail, notices and weekly bulletins for the purpose of maintaining communications with parents and community. Assist with preparation of student and staff handbooks and newsletters for the purpose of maintaining current information for the year. Maintain school inventory, manage requisitions, and issue requests for equipment maintenance for the purpose of keeping the school stocked and in good repair. Assist with supervision of clerks for the purpose of maintaining a cohesive work environment. Maintain a high level of confidentiality regarding student and staff information in order to remain in compliance with legal requirements and to maintain a professional work environment. Perform other duties as assigned for the purpose of 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the work unit.
P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S/ENVIRONMENTAL CONDITIONS
Physical and emotional ability and dexterity to perform required work and move about as needed in a fast-pace, high-intensive work environment.
T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T
At will
PERFORMANCE REVIEW
Performance effectiveness evaluated in accordance with Kansas Statutes and Board of Education Policy.
